Soccer Preview: Eastwood vs. Maumee
After three games on the road, Eastwood is heading back home. They will host the Maumee Panthers at 4:15 p.m. on Wednesday. Eastwood's last three games have been decided by no more than a goal, so don't be surprised if it's a close one.
Last Saturday, Eastwood and Swanton finished up their match with a 4-4 draw.
Eastwood hit Swanton with a three-pronged attack, as the team got scores from
Austin Miller (2),
Hayden Cadaret, and
Everett Ward.
Meanwhile, Maumee put another one in the bag on Monday to keep their perfect season alive. They were the clear victor by an 11-3 margin over Bowsher. The Panthers might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won eight contests by three goals or more this season.
Eastwood's draw gives them a new season record of 2-6-3. As for Maumee, their victory was their sixth straight on the road, which pushed their record up to 9-0.
